What is the JC-STAR?
The
JC-STAR is a security evaluation and labeling scheme initiated by the Japanese Ministry of Economy, Trade and Industry (METI) and managed by the Information-Technology Promotion Agency (IPA). This program aims to assess and visualize the security levels of IoT products, facilitating consumer choice when selecting secure devices. Starting in March 2025, it will formally operate under technical requirements aligned with international standards such as
ETSI EN 303 645 and
NISTIR 8425.
With cyber threats on the rise, the JC-STAR provides a valuable framework for manufacturers to meet stringent security protocols. Buffalo has actively pursued JC-STAR compliance since the program’s inception, allowing customers to benefit from a safer online experience.
Key Features of WXR9300BE6P
The
WXR9300BE6P tri-band router boasts several cutting-edge features:
- - Wi-Fi 7 Compatibility: Supporting the latest wireless standard for improved connectivity.
- - Tri-band Capability: Utilizing three frequency bands for optimal performance.
- - External Antennas: Equipped with a 3-axis rotating external antenna for enhanced signal coverage.
- - 10Gbps Wired Internet Ports: Supports multiple wired connections with speeds of up to 10Gbps.
- - Network Threat Blocker 2 Premium: This feature safeguards users against online threats, enhancing the overall security of the home network.
Advanced Security Specifications
Buffalo's compliance with the JC-STAR standard brings various stringent security measures to the WXR9300BE6P and other compatible products:
- - Unique Login Credentials: Individualized default passwords for enhanced security.
- - Mandatory Password Change: Initial setup requires users to create a new password, minimizing unauthorized access.
- - Access Restrictions: Account lockout after multiple failed login attempts to deter brute force attacks.
- - Encryption of Configuration Data: Ensuring that stored settings are secure from unauthorized access.
- - Automatic Firmware Updates: Critical security updates are seamlessly applied, keeping systems protected against vulnerabilities.
- - Security Updates During Support Period: Continuously providing essential updates throughout the device's life cycle.
- - Malware Containment Measures in Supply Chain: Mitigating risks associated with malware in development and manufacturing processes.
